Pure round robin scheduling processes A, then B, then C, then starts at A again. (A, B, C might be tasks in an operating system context, or devices in a master/slave control network, or whatever.) That is, pure round robin scheduling doesn't acknowledge priorities, and does not allow out-of-order processing. Real-life systems typically use a mixture of algorithms that, together, allow for prioritized and out-of-order processing while, on the other hand, trying to prevent starvation of lower priority items.
